Armenia vs Madagascar statistics compared

Updated on by Georank team

Armenia has a population of 3.03M (ranked 135/197), compared with 32M in Madagascar (ranked 49/197). Armenia's land area is 10,888 sq mi versus 224,634 sq mi for Madagascar (ranked 138th vs. 44th).

By GDP, Armenia ranks 114/197 ($26B) and Madagascar ranks 136/197 ($17.4B). By GDP per capita, Armenia ranks 90/197 ($8,556), while Madagascar ranks 193/197 ($545).
